JAN. 19: WINTER TRAILS DAY

JANUARY 19, 2013
There’s more than one way to experience outdoor winter fun. Many find the thrill and adventure of walking in the snow in pristine areas far outweigh the experience of paying to schuss down an icy slope. For those interested in learning how to experience nature while enjoying the winter landscape, the Winter Trails organization and Estes Park's Winter Festival organizers have just the answer: the 17th annual Winter Trails Day in Rocky Mountain National Park on Jan. 19, 2013.

Learn how to snowshoe, try complimentary snowshoes from you choice of manufacturers (Tubbs, Atlas, MSR, Crescent Moon and more). Receive expert advice on selecting and fitting snowshoes, along with other fun ideas about how to enjoy winter in the mountains. Don't miss the igloo - a crowd favorite!

Participants can attend free informational clinics which include educational stations on winter activity basics, safety techniques, nutrition and hydration tips, essential conditioning exercises and how to dress for winter hiking and camping. The national Winter Trails organization and REI sponsor the free event.

Winter Trails Day will be held at the Park and Ride lot on Bear Lake Road in Rocky Mountain National Park. All activities are free. Also stay for fee free day at Rocky Mountain National Park on Monday, January 21st, when you get complimentary access to one of the country's most popular national parks.
